L'autore

Robert G. Gann received his Ph.D. in Electrical Engineering in 1986 from Colorado State University. Since 1989, he has worked as a design engineer at Hewlett-Packard where he has been responsible for image quality specification and evaluation of HP ScanJet scanners. He has traveled worldwide, giving classes in testing scanners to audiences ranging from novice users to image scientists. Previous editions of his highly-successful Reviewing and Testing Desktop Scanners provide a strong basis for this new guidebook.

The “no-hype” expert guide to choosing your next scanner.

Bewildered by today's complex scanner specs? Need to filter the hype from the reality? Desktop Scanners: Image Quality Evaluation delivers the practical, objective information you need to choose the best scanner — and get great results from it. Detailed enough for experts yet clear enough for beginners, it's like having a world-class scanning expert by your side throughout the entire evaluation, purchase and configuration process. You'll get answers to key questions like:

  • What kind of scanner do I need? Are those new low-cost scanners really enough?
  • How does a scanner actually work, and how can I make mine work better?
  • What do those DPI and bit-depth specifications mean — if anything?
  • How do I scan for accurate color on the Web?
  • What options and software do I need?
  • How are scanners changing, and which new technologies are most important?

From the absolute basics to sophisticated gamma correction and color space issues, here are the practical answers and step-by-step testing procedures you need to get the most for your money. When it comes to scanners, you'll never be “in the dark” again.

On the accompanying CD-ROM, you'll find example images, scanner evaluation tools, online presentations, and further explanations of key concepts.
